This review is from: David Clark H10-13.4 Aviation Headset

I have not tried an ANR (electronic noise canceling) headset to compare, as I can't get myself to shell out close to $1000 -- yet. What surprised me about the David Clark series was how many people vouched for their durability and customer service. I chose this relatively newer model 10-13.4 over the more traditional 10-30/40 series because I preferred the gooseneck-style mic boom. My head and ears are not overly large, and the headset is very comfortable, provides an effective seal against noise, was not objectionably hot nor heavy during summertime, and allowed wearing sunglasses without any problems. The pillow top spreads the headset weight on my head so I don't really notice them. The longest flight segment I have flown with these is only about 2 hours, so I cannot judge if long flight segments remain as comfortable.

A purchaser will need to order a carrying case, and one might also order some extra ear cushions.

To compare, I tried my instructor's minimalist Clarity Aloft ($500+) -- a completely different style of extremely lightweight, in-the-ear passive NR headset and found them comparable in noise abatement, but much lighter. Other pilots who fly a lot prefer this style.

Pro: Excellent model for the price point, good quality manufacturing, reportedly excellent customer service. No need for batteries and similar maintenance of ANR style headsets.

Con: Would be nice if the manufacturers would include a carrying case for the headsets....



This review is from: David Clark H10-13.4 Aviation Headset

Listen, people, there's a reason this headset (and the older version) is worn by more pilots than any other. Simply put, they do what they're supposed to do, without any fuss.

The gel ear cups are super comfy and seal to your head even when wearing thick-framed sunglasses, and don't press the arms of the glasses into your temples.

The boom mic stays put and sounds great - directional electret rejects most ambient noise in noisy cockpits, when windows open during taxi, etc. In other words, your co-pilot and the tower hear you, not your airplane, when you key-up.

Add an in-line BlueTooth adapter to listen to music through the stereo 13.4's - no need to spend $1000 for Bose or Lightspeeds to get BlueTooth. And the drivers actually sound great for music, not just intercom speech.

Made in America with an honest warranty, and an honest company that actually stands behind their product. You won't regret this purchase....
